One dated edition a week on what was filed at the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ission: transmission and pipeline rate changes, gas certificate applications, hydro licensing, complaints and Commission orders — cut into the segments an energy analyst or a ratepayer advocate actually works. About half of every week is routine quarterly paperwork; it is counted and kept out of the listings rather than padding them. FERC is wholesale and interstate: retail rate cases stay at the state commissions and are not covered.
